How much do community engagement int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for community engagement intern in Quebec is $18.79,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.90 and $19.95 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What types of projects and collaborations can a community engagement intern expect to be involved with during their internship?

As a Community Engagement Intern, you will typically work on projects that foster relationships between the organization and its stakeholders, such as community events, outreach campaigns, and social media initiatives. You may collaborate closely with communications, marketing, and program teams to coordinate activities, gather feedback, and amplify community voices. Interns often help plan and execute events, create content for various platforms, and assist with data collection or reporting. This hands-on experience provides insight into nonprofit or corporate engagement strategies and offers opportunities to build professional networks and learn from experienced team members.

What does a community engagement intern do?

A Community Engagement Intern assists organizations in building and maintaining relationships with community members, stakeholders, and partners. Their responsibilities often include organizing events, supporting outreach initiatives, managing social media or communications, and gathering feedback from the community. This role is valuable for gaining experience in public relations, communications, and project management while making a positive impact in the community.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a community engagement int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Community Engagement Intern, you need strong communication, organizational, and interpersonal skills, often complemented by coursework or experience in public relations, communications, or social sciences. Familiarity with social media platforms, event planning tools, and CRM systems is typically beneficial. Proactive problem-solving, adaptability, and cultural sensitivity are valuable soft skills that help foster genuine community connections. These abilities are essential for effectively building relationships, promoting organizational initiatives, and ensuring positive community impact.

Haven Studios is a game development studio headquartered in Montreal. In May 2021, we embarked on a journey to start Haven as a small team with big ambitions. Our goal was to build a studio of exceptional people where together we could make the kind of games we've always wanted to create - games we've longed to play. At Haven, we believe that kindness, adaptability and fearless optimism make space for creative excellence. We are a hybrid studio that supports flexibility, focus and collaboration for our teams.

Haven joined the PlayStation Studios family as the first Sony game development team in Canada in 2022. Our first game is in development for PlayStation and PC, a competitive multiplayer action heist game with a vision to entertain and engage players for years to come.

Position - Community & Social Media Intern - Fall-Winter 2026

About the Role:

We're looking for a curious, creative, and community-minded intern who's passionate about multiplayer games and the communities that form around them. This internship is designed for someone who lives online-whether that's creating content on TikTok, spending time in Discord communities, watching Twitch, or following the latest multiplayer games.

You'll work alongside our Community team to help engage players, support social and creator initiatives, and learn how community management operates inside an AAA game studio. No two days are the same-you'll contribute to player conversations, content creation, feedback analysis, creator programs, and live playtests while gaining firsthand experience helping launch a brand-new live service game.
This role offers broad exposure across Community, Marketing, Production, Player Experience, and Live Operations, making it an excellent opportunity for someone eager to build a career in the games industry.

What You'll Do
  • Community Engagement

    • Engage daily with players across Discord and other community platforms.

    • Help answer questions, encourage conversations, and foster a welcoming, inclusive environment.

    • Identify recurring questions, trends, and emerging discussions.

  • Social & Content:

    • Support the creation of short-form social content for platforms like TikTok, YouTube Shorts, Instagram, and X.

    • Collaborate with the Community Content Manager to plan, prepare, and publish community communications.

    • Assist with basic video editing, image creation, and social asset production.

  • Player Insights:

    • Monitor player conversations and sentiment across social platforms and Discord.

    • Capture community feedback and summarize actionable insights for development teams.

    • Help identify emerging community trends and opportunities.

  • Team & Partner Coordination:

    • Partner with Community, Marketing, and Player Experience teams.

    • Learn the tools and workflows that support a modern live game.
